2025 Social Security and Medicare Figures compared to the 2024 Figures
On October 10, 2024, the Social Security Administration "SSA" announced all the 2025 figures. The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), an agency under the Department of Health and Human Services announced the 2025 Medicare premiums and deductibles on November 8, 2024. The table below is a summary of the new 2025 Social Security and Medicare figures compared to 2024. The last four 2025 Medicare Part D figures at the end of the table were released on April 1, 2024.
The cost-of-living adjustment (COLA) for 2025 is 2.5%. In 2025, the full retirement age (FRA) is 66 and 10 months (was 66 and 8 months in 2024). Some of the following Social Security program figures relate to when a person attains FRA.
